Service Versions

A service version provides a range of functional and non-functional specifications that hold for that version of the service. You can define service routing rules to route a percentage of traffic to backend instances of that version. You can also use traffic policies to define service groups with different version labels.

Viewing a Service Version

  1. Log in to the UCS console. In the navigation pane, choose Service Meshes.
  2. Click the name of the target service mesh to go to its details page.
  3. In the navigation pane, choose Service Center > Mesh Services.
  4. Click the service name and then click the tab for displaying service discovery.
  5. View the service version.
  6. Click Monitoring in the Operation column to view the following information:

    • Inbound throughput (RPS)
    • Outbound throughput (RPS)
    • Average latency
    • Outbound traffic error rate
    • Inbound traffic error rate
